/* CSS Document */

BODY {
 margin:0 0 0 10;
 TEXT-ALIGN:center;  
}
#head
{
width:1000px;
float:left;
padding:0px;
margin:0px;
}


#main
{
overflow:hidden;
width:960px;
max-width:954px;
text-align:left;
border:0px solid #CCCCCC;
background-image:url(images/bg_shaddow.gif);
background-repeat:repeat-y;
margin-right:auto;
margin-left:auto;
padding-left:6px;

}


.logo
{
float:left;
background-color:#f5f2eb;
}

.banner_front
{
padding-top:10px;
}

.head_2
{
float:left;
margin:0px;
margin:0px;
}

head2menu
{
margin-left:10px;
}

.head_logo
{
float:left;
background-image:url(images/head2left_bg.gif);
background-position:right;
background-repeat:repeat-y;
padding-right:16px;
background-color:#f8f6f1;
}




.data_1
{
float:left;
width:214px;
margin:0px;
padding:0px;
background-color:#FFFFFF;
background-image:url(images/head2left_bg.gif);
background-position:right;
background-repeat:repeat-y;
}


.data1
{
width:198px;
background-color:#f5f2eb;
float:left;

}


.data1_
{
/*float:left;*/
clear:both; display:block;
width:214px;
margin:0px;
padding:0px;

background-color:#FFFFFF;
overflow:hidden;

}
.data1_ img { border:0; margin:0; padding:0;
overflow:hidden; }


.net
{
padding-top:18px;
padding-left:18px;
background-color:#f5f2eb;
padding-bottom:15px;
padding-right:16px;
height:123px;
float:left;
width:154px;
max-width:198px;

}


.data2
{float:left;
width:490px;
margin-left:15px;
display:inline;
max-width:490px;
}

.title1
{
font-family:tahoma;
font-weight:bold;
font-size:14px;
color:#19499f;
border-bottom:1px dashed #005aab;
width:490px;
float:left;
line-height:15px;
}

.text1
{
padding-top:10px;
font-family:tahoma;
font-size:12px;
color:#333366;
line-height:20px;
width:490px;
float:left;

}
.text2
{
padding-top:10px;
font-family:tahoma;
font-size:12px;
color:#333366;
line-height:20px;
width:680px;
float:left;

}
.data3
{
margin-left:40px;
float:left;
width:180px;
margin-right:2px;
display:inline;
}
*html .data3
{ 
 margin-left:30px;
}

.support_txt
{
width:171px;
max-width:181px;
color:#213d79;
font-size:10px;
font-family:tahoma;
background-color:#d4e4f5;
float:left;
padding:1px 5px 5px 5px;
}

.perissotera1
{
float:left;
width:180px;
height:21px;
background-image:url(images/support_enhmer.gif);
background-repeat:no-repeat;
}

.perissotera1 a
{
float:left;
width:180px;
height:21px;
background-image:url(images/support_enhmer.gif);
background-repeat:no-repeat;
text-decoration:none;
color:#6699cc;
text-align:right;
padding-top:5px;
}

.perissotera1txt
{

padding-top:20px;
font-family:tahoma;
color:#4f92c3;
font-size:10px;
font-weight:bold;
}

.latest_news
{
padding-top:15px;
float:left;
background-color:#FFFFFF;
}

.latest_date
{
color:#d41010;
background-color:#FFFFFF;
font-size:10px;
font-weight:bold;
font-family:tahoma;
padding-left:5px;
width:170px;
max-width:165px;
float:left;
padding-top:10px;
}
.latest_news1
{
float:left;
color:#27488e;
font-size:11px;
font-family:tahoma;
padding-left:5px;
}

.latest_news_more a
{
border-bottom:1px solid #f2efe8;
color:#4f92c3;
float:left;
width:170px;
max-width:165px;
font-family:tahoma;
font-size:10px;
padding-left:5px;
line-height:25px;
text-decoration:none;
}

.login
{
width:182px;
background-color:#f5f2eb;
float:left;


}


.request
{
font-family:tahoma;
font-size:11px;
color:#273167;
font-weight:bold;
margin-left:16px;
margin-right:5px;

}

.name_logged{
background-color:red;
color:#197a47;
font-family:tahoma;
font-size:11px;
padding-left:100px;
margin-left:100px;
font-weight:normal;
}

.name
{
color:#197a47;
font-family:tahoma;
font-size:11px;
font-weight:bold;
margin-left:16px;
padding-top:5px;
line-height:40px;
}

.name_txtbox
{
color:#005aab;
font-family:tahoma;
font-size:11px;
font-weight:bold;
border:1px solid #a5acb2;
margin-top:10px;
width:100px;
margin-left:18px;
}

.name_txtbox2
{
color:#005aab;
font-family:tahoma;
font-size:11px;
border:1px solid #a5acb2;
font-weight:bold;
margin-top:10px;
margin-left:10px;
width:100px;
}

.password
{
color:#197a47;
font-family:tahoma;
font-size:11px;
font-weight:bold;
margin-left:16px;
padding-top:5px;
line-height:40px;
}

.entry a
{
font-family:tahoma;
font-size:13px;
color:#d4100f;
line-height:35px;
margin-left:110px;
text-decoration:none;
font-weight:bold;
}
.forget
{

font-family:tahoma;
font-size:11px;

color:#005aab;
padding-left:16px;
}

.logout a
{
font-family:tahoma;
width:170px;
max-width:20px;
font-size:11px;
color:#005aab;
padding-left:150px;
text-decoration:underline
}

.forget a
{
font-weight:bold;
font-family:tahoma;
font-size:11px;
color:#005aab;
padding-left:0px;
text-decoration:underline

}

.hypercode
{
padding-top:18px;
padding-left:18px;
background-color:#f5f2eb;
padding-bottom:15px;
padding-right:16px;
float:left;
}

.emailrequest
{

padding-left:10px;
font-family:tahoma;
font-size:11px;
color:#005aab;
}

.emailtxtbox
{
margin:10px;
border: 1px solid #a5acb2;
}

.closure
{
background-color:#FFFFFF;
}

.title2_
{
font-family:tahoma;
color:#2285db;
font-size:12px;
padding-left:5px;
font-weight:bold;
width:680px;
max-width:675px;
float:left;
padding-top:10px;
border-bottom: dashed 1px #005aab;
line-height:20px;
}

.title2
{
font-family:tahoma;
color:#2285db;
font-size:12px;
padding-left:5px;
font-weight:bold;
width:490px;
max-width:485px;
float:left;
padding-top:10px;
border-bottom: dashed 1px #005aab;
line-height:20px;
}

.diataxeis_new
{
float:left;
}

.diataxeis_title
{

font-family:tahoma;
font-size:14px;
background-image:url(images/diataxeis_line.gif);
background-repeat:repeat-x;
background-position:bottom;
background-color:#f0ede5;
color:#d41010;
font-weight:bold;
float:left;
width:490px;
max-width:480px;
line-height:25px;
padding-left:10px;
margin-top:20px;

}

.neesdiataxeis
{

float:left;
width:490px;
margin-top:5px;
}
.neesdiataxeis a
{
text-align:right;
margin:0px;
font-family:tahoma;
font-size:11px;
color:#2285db;
text-decoration:none;
font-weight:bold;
}
.neesdiataxeis a:HOVER
{
font-family:tahoma;
font-size:11px;
color:#cf0e0e;
text-decoration:underline;
font-weight:bold;
}
.diataxeistxt
{
font-family:tahoma;
font-size:11px;
background-color:#fbf9f6;
color:#000000;
line-height:20px;
width:490px;
max-width:480px;
padding-left:10px;
padding-right:0px;
}
.diataxeistxt2
{
font-family:tahoma;
font-size:11px;
background-color:#fbf9f6;
color:#000000;
line-height:25px;
width:490px;
max-width:478px;
padding-left:10px;
padding-right:0px;
border-bottom:1px dashed #005aab;
}

#footer
{
float:left;
background-image:url(images/closure.gif);
background-repeat:repeat-x;
width:950px;
height:25px;
max-height:20px;
padding-top:5px;
}

.copyright
{
font-family:tahoma;
font-size:10px;
color:#FFFFFF;
padding-left:11px;
width:730px;
float:left;
}

.closing_logo
{
margin-left:80px;
float:left;
}



.text1 a
{
font-family:tahoma;
font-size:15px;
text-decoration:none;
color:#2285db;
}

.content
{
padding-left:27px;
font-family:tahoma;
font-size:12px;
color:#323C76;
line-height:20px;
float:left;
line-height:15px;

}

.text_in
{
font-family:tahoma;
font-size:12px;
color:#323C76;
line-height:20px;
float:left;
line-height:15px;

}
.data4
{
width:720px;
float:left;
padding-bottom:30px
}

.column1
{
width:230px;
float:left;
}

.column2
{
width:230px;
float:left;
}

.column3
{
width:230px;
float:left;
}

.path1
{
width:725px;
background-image:url(images/path_bg.gif);
background-repeat:repeat-x;
height:32px;
margin:0px;
padding:0px;
float:left;
}



.path1txt
{
padding-left:30px;
padding-top:10px;
color:#cf0e0e;
font-family:tahoma;
font-size:12px;
font-weight:bold;
}

a.pathclick 
{
padding-top:10px;
color:#cf0e0e;
font-family:tahoma;
font-size:12px;
font-weight:bold;
} 


.data4_title
{
width:720px;
width:693px;
background-color:#FFFFFF;
border-bottom:1px dashed #005aab;
height:25px;
float:left;
padding-left:27px;
}

.data4_titletxt
{
color:#2285db;
font-family:tahoma;
font-size:12px;
font-weight:bold;
}

.data4_moretxt
{
padding-left:15px;
padding-top:5px;
color:#323c76;
font-family:tahoma;
font-size:11px;
font-weight:bold;
background-color:#FFFFFF;
float:left;
}

.column1list
{
background-image:url(images/products_bullet.gif);
background-position:left;
background-repeat:no-repeat;
padding-left:20px;
color:#323c76;
font-family:tahoma;
font-size:11px;
padding-top:10px;
padding-bottom:10px;
}

.column1list a
{
color:#323c76;
font-family:tahoma;
font-size:11px;
padding-top:10px;
padding-bottom:10px;
text-decoration:none;
}

.poliseis
{
float:left;
width:500px;
}

.poliseis_title
{
font-family:tahoma;
font-size:11px;
padding-top:10px;
padding-bottom:10px;
color:#eb2d2e;
padding-left:15px;
font-weight:bold;
}

.poliseis_txt
{
float:left;
font-family:tahoma;
font-size:12px;
padding-left:15px;
line-height:15px;
}

.data5
{
width:730px;
float:left;
margin:0px;
padding:0px;

}

.data5date
{
padding-left:30px;
font-family:tahoma;
font-size:10px;
font-weight:bold;
color:#323c76;
line-height:20px;
}

.data5title
{
padding-left:0px;
font-family:tahoma;
font-size:13px;
font-weight:bold;
color:#323c76;
line-height:25px;
}

.data5shortdescription
{
padding-left:30px;
font-family:tahoma;
font-size:12px;
color:#000000;
line-height:20px;
}

.data5more
{
font-family:tahoma;
font-size:11px;
color:#333333;
line-height:20px;
}

.data5more a
{
font-family:tahoma;
font-size:11px;
color:#2285db;
text-decoration:none;
line-height:20px;
margin-left:600px;
}

.neaki1
{
padding:0px;
margin:0px;
border-bottom: 1px #005aab dashed;
float:left;
width:490px;
}

.neaki2
{
padding:0px;
margin:0px;
border-bottom: 1px #005aab dashed;
float:left;
width:680px;
}

.paging
{
margin-top:40px;
margin-bottom:20px;
width:660px;
float:left;
}


.previous a
{
width:120px;
max-width:100px;
font-family:tahoma;
color:#2285db;
font-size:12px;
text-decoration:none;
padding-left:20px;
float:left;
}

.next a
{
font-family:tahoma;
color:#2285db;
font-size:12px;
text-decoration:none;
margin-left:460px;
float:left;
width:80px;
}

.diataxeis_moretxt
{
font-family:tahoma;
font-size:11px;
color:#666666;
padding-left:15px;
padding-top:10px;
line-height:15px;
}

.center
{
width:1000px;
float::left
}

.contact1
{
font-family:tahoma;
font-size:11px;
width:150px;
max-width:135px;
font-weight:bold;
line-height:35px;
padding-left:15px;
color:#333333;
float:left;
}

.contacttextbox
{
width:400px;
float:left;
padding-top:10px;
padding-bottom:10px;
}

.data_contact
{
float:left;
margin-top:11px;
}


.forma
{
float:left;
width:341px;
background-color:#fbf9f6;
}

.forma2
{
float:left;
width:441px;
background-color:#fbf9f6;
} 
.forma_title
{
width:351px;
font-family:tahoma;
font-size:12px;
font-weight:bold;
background-image:url(images/forma_bg.gif);
background-repeat:repeat-x;
color:#1a4da2;
line-height:28px;
padding:0px;
margin:0px;
}
.forma_title2
{
width:451px;
font-family:tahoma;
font-size:12px;
font-weight:bold;
background-image:url(images/forma_bg.gif);
background-repeat:repeat-x;
color:#1a4da2;
line-height:28px;
padding:0px;
margin:0px;
}
.forma_titletxt2
{
padding-left:10px;
background-image:url(images/formatitl_bg.gif);
background-repeat:repeat-x;
height:20px;
width:450px;
height:30px;
line-height:30px;
}
.forma_titletxt
{
padding-left:10px;
background-image:url(images/formatitl_bg.gif);
background-repeat:repeat-x;
height:20px;
width:350px;
height:30px;
line-height:30px;
max-width:340px;
}
.form_til2
{
background-color:#fbf9f6;
float:left;
padding-left:10px;
max-width:190px;
width:200px;
background-image:url(images/formbg2.gif);
background-repeat:repeat-x;
background-position:center;
font-family:tahoma;
font-size:12px;
line-height:20px;
padding-top:5px;
text-align:right;
padding-bottom:5px;
}
.form_til
{
background-color:#fbf9f6;
float:left;
padding-left:10px;
max-width:130px;
width:140px;
background-image:url(images/formbg2.gif);
background-repeat:repeat-x;
background-position:center;
font-family:tahoma;
font-size:12px;
line-height:20px;
padding-top:5px;
text-align:right;
padding-bottom:5px;
}

.form_til3
{
background-image:url(images/formbg2.gif);
background-repeat:repeat-x;
background-position:center;
padding-left:150px;
padding-bottom:20px;
}

.forma_text
{
margin-left:20px;
width:300px;
float:left;
font-family:tahoma;
font-size:12px;
color:#273167;
padding-top:35px;
}
.forma_text a
{
font-family:tahoma;
font-size:12px;
color:#273167;
}
.forma_text a:hover
{
font-family:tahoma;
font-size:12px;
color:#1a4da2;
}
.error
{
font-family:tahoma;
font-size:10px;
color:#993300;
width:350px;
line-height:15px;
padding-left:150px;
}
.error2
{
font-family:tahoma;
font-size:10px;
color:#993300;
width:450px;
line-height:15px;
padding-left:200px;
}

.sendbtn
{
font-family:tahoma;
font-size:12px;
color:#993300;
align:center;
margin-left:150px;
border:0px;
}

.lastnewred a
{
color:#4f92c3;
float:left;
width:170px;
max-width:165px;
font-family:tahoma;
font-size:10px;
padding-left:5px;
line-height:25px;
text-decoration:none;
border-bottom:1px #ff0000 dashed;
}
#atcomProductionFlash {
	float:left;
	margin:0px;
	padding:0px;	
	width:20px;
}
.atcom {
float:left;
margin:0px;
padding:0px;		
}
.atcom a {
font-family:tahoma, verdana,;
font-size: 10px;
font-weight: normal;
text-decoration: none;
color: #e0e0e0;
}
.atcom a:hover {
font-family:tahoma,verdana, ;
font-size: 10px;
font-weight: normal;
text-decoration: none;
color: #ffffff;
}


.poll_right
{
margin:10px 0px 0px 0px;
float:left;
background-color:#ffffff;
width:180px;
color:#27488e;
font-size:11px;
font-family:tahoma;
border-bottom: dashed 1px #1a4da2;
}
.votetxt
{
margin:0px 0px 0px 0px;
float:left;
background-color:#ffffff;
width:180px;
max-width:175px;
color:#27488e;
font-size:11px;
padding:5px 0px 5px 0px;
font-family:tahoma;
font-weight:bold
}

.votechoice1txt
{
margin:0px 0px 0px 0px;
float:left;
background-color:#ffffff;
width:180px;
color:#27488e;
font-size:11px;
font-family:tahoma;
}
.votechoice1txt_left
{
margin:0px 0px 0px 0px;
float:left;
background-color:#ffffff;
width:20px;
color:#27488e;
font-size:11px;
font-family:tahoma;
}
.votechoice1txt_right
{
margin:0px 0px 0px 0px;
float:left;
background-color:#ffffff;
width:160px;
color:#27488e;
font-size:11px;
font-family:tahoma;
}

.psifise
{
text-align:center;
margin:5px 0px 0px 0px;
padding-bottom:5px;
float:left;
background-color:#ffffff;
color:#27488e;
font-size:11px;
font-family:tahoma;
}

.votechoice1txt
{
margin:0px 0px 2px 0px;
float:left;
width:180px;
color:#27488e;
font-size:11px;
font-family:tahoma;
padding:2px 0px 2px 0px;
border-bottom: solid 1px #cbdef0;
}





.votechoice1percent
{
margin:2px 0px 0px 0px;
float:left;
background-color:#ffffff;
width:180px;
color:#27488e;
font-size:11px;
font-family:tahoma;
}
.percentagebar
{
margin:0px 0px 0px 0px;
float:left;
background-color:#ffffff;
width:100px;
color:#27488e;
font-size:11px;
font-family:tahoma;
border:1px solid #74b9f6
}
.percent
{
margin:0px 0px 0px 0px;
padding:0px 0px 0px 5px;
float:left;
background-color:#ffffff;
width:75px;
max-width:70px;
color:#27488e;
font-size:11px;
font-family:tahoma;

}
.text
{
font: normal 11px Tahoma;
color:#333366;
line-height:20px;
float:left;

}
.white
{
font: normal 11px Tahoma;
color:#ffffff;
line-height:20px;
float:left;

}



